Output 51729339833e4e5eaafe06030b77acec4495fbbce2e1378f6bc1767571e18b05:1

value
10473668
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 878e1e5b6d27a12bc08c6832500f566ed3aa49d6 OP_EQUALVERIFY OP_CHECKSIG
address
1DMkUUDqzWC48S7Gucb3NYAyWEXXBxW5VY
transaction
51729339833e4e5eaafe06030b77acec4495fbbce2e1378f6bc1767571e18b05
spent
true